Alexander Ralls was found guilty of offences at Queen Ethelburga’s School

Former pupils who were subjected to sexual abuse at a prestigious York public school are being urged to reach out for support.

Alexander Charles Ralls worked as a child protection officer at York public school Queen Ethelburga’s from 2011 until 2015, when he was suspended and subsequently dismissed from teaching following a complaint made by a former student.

During a six-week trial at Bradford Crown Court which took place last year, evidence was heard that over a four-year period Ralls had abused his position to take advantage of his victims both in the UK, and while on school trips abroad.

He was later convicted on 31 charged of sexual assault, 10 charges of causing a person to engage in sexual activity without consent and two charges of assault by penetration, and is now serving a 16-year prison sentence.

In 2021, the school’s former owner, Brian Martin, was also jailed for non-recent child abuse.
